克兰费尔特综合征:一种导致儿童神经内分泌改变和精神病理易感性的遗传性疾病——文献综述与病例报告

Klinefelter Syndrome: A Genetic Disorder Leading to Neuroendocrine Modifications and Psychopathological Vulnerabilities in Children-A Literature Review and Case Report.

Abstract

Klinefelter syndrome (KS), characterized by an additional X-chromosome in males, manifests in a wide range of neuroendocrine and psychiatric symptoms. Individuals with KS often face increased risks of hormonal dysfunction, leading to depression and anxiety, although extended research during pediatric and adolescent age is still limited. This critical phase, decisive for KS children, is influenced by a combination of genetic, environmental and familial factors, which impact brain plasticity. In this report, we reviewed, in a narrative form, the crucial KS psychopathological hallmarks in children. To better describe neuroendocrine and neuropsychiatric outcomes in children with KS, we presented the case of an 11-year-old prepubertal child with mosaic KS who was referred to our Center of Developmental Psychopathology due to a decline in his academic performance, excessive daytime fatigue and increased distractibility over the past few months. Family history revealed psychiatric conditions among first- and second-degree relatives, including recently divorced parents and a 15-year-old sister. Early-onset persistent depressive disorder and anxious traits were diagnosed. Timely identification of susceptible children, with thorough examination of familial psychiatric history, environmental influences and neurocognitive profile, alongside targeted interventions, could potentially mitigate lifelong psychopathology-related disabilities in pediatric and adolescent KS cases, including those with mosaic KS.

摘要

克兰费尔特综合征(KS)的特征是男性额外多了一条X染色体,表现为广泛的神经内分泌和精神症状。KS患者往往面临激素功能障碍风险增加的问题,进而导致抑郁和焦虑,不过针对儿童和青少年时期的深入研究仍然有限。这个对KS患儿至关重要的阶段受到遗传、环境和家庭因素的综合影响,这些因素会影响大脑可塑性。在本报告中,我们以叙述形式回顾了儿童KS关键的精神病理学特征。为了更好地描述KS患儿的神经内分泌和神经精神学结果,我们介绍了一名11岁青春期前的嵌合型KS患儿的病例,该患儿因过去几个月学业成绩下降、白天过度疲劳和注意力分散加剧而被转诊至我们的发育精神病理学中心。家族史显示一级和二级亲属中有精神疾病,包括最近离婚的父母和一个15岁的姐姐。该患儿被诊断为早发性持续性抑郁障碍和焦虑特质。及时识别易感儿童,全面检查家族精神病史、环境影响和神经认知特征,并进行针对性干预,可能会减轻儿科和青少年KS病例(包括嵌合型KS病例)与精神病理学相关的终身残疾。
